Understanding Cordless Weed Eaters
A cordless weed eater, also known as a string trimmer or weed whacker, is a handheld tool designed to cut grass, weeds, and small plants. Unlike gas-powered or corded electric models, cordless weed eaters operate on rechargeable batteries, providing freedom of movement and ease of use. They are ideal for small to medium-sized yards and offer several advantages, including:
- Portability: No cords to trip over or gas to refill.
- Ease of use: Lightweight and easy to maneuver.
- Environmentally friendly: No emissions or noise pollution.
- Low maintenance: Fewer moving parts mean less wear and tear.
Key Features to Look for in the Best Cordless Weed Eater
When shopping for the best cordless weed eater, consider the following features to ensure you get a reliable and efficient tool:
Battery Life and Power
The battery is the heart of a cordless weed eater. Look for models with lithium-ion batteries, which offer longer run times and faster charging. Battery voltage indicates power, with higher voltages generally providing more cutting power. However, higher voltage doesn't always mean better performance, so consider the amp-hours (Ah) rating as well, which indicates how long the battery will last.
Cutting Head and Line
The cutting head and line are crucial for effective weed cutting. Automatic feed systems are convenient, as they advance the line as needed. Look for models with dual-line heads for better cutting performance and durability. The line diameter and material also matter; thicker lines (0.080 to 0.105 inches) are more durable but may require more power.
Weight and Ergonomics
A lightweight and well-balanced weed eater reduces fatigue during use. Look for models with ergonomic handles and adjustable shafts to accommodate different heights and working positions. Some models also feature vibration reduction technology for added comfort.

Maintaining Your Cordless Weed Eater
Proper maintenance is essential for keeping your cordless weed eater in top condition. Here are some tips to ensure longevity and optimal performance:
- Regularly inspect the cutting line and replace it as needed. A dull or worn line can reduce cutting efficiency.
- Clean the cutting head and remove any debris after each use. This prevents buildup and ensures smooth operation.
- Store your weed eater in a dry, cool place to protect the battery and other components from damage.
- Charge the battery according to the manufacturer's instructions. Avoid overcharging or deep discharging, as this can shorten battery life.
- Periodically check the battery for signs of wear or damage, such as leaks or swelling. Replace the battery if necessary.

Safety Tips for Using a Cordless Weed Eater
Safety is paramount when operating a cordless weed eater. Here are some tips to ensure safe and efficient use:
- Wear appropriate protective gear, including safety glasses, gloves, and sturdy shoes. This protects you from debris and potential injuries.
- Clear the work area of obstacles, such as rocks, sticks, and toys. This prevents damage to the weed eater and reduces the risk of injury.
- Keep bystanders, especially children and pets, at a safe distance. The cutting line can cause serious injuries if it comes into contact with skin or eyes.
- Use the weed eater in a well-ventilated area to avoid inhaling dust and debris. Consider wearing a dust mask for added protection.
- Follow the manufacturer's instructions for starting, operating, and stopping the weed eater. This ensures safe and efficient use.
